Too Weak To Stand

I see a spot e’er candles burn &
lovers watch the night the hollow sound
inside yerself keeps telling you ta write and
songs of love will ne’er leave such lovers
feeling soiled yet tides turnin’ waves
a burning whilst water fill such
toiling price... look love
has risen till the
ceiling won’t
withstand
a price

love
has
risen
till the
ceilings
can’t cave

in the tears you’ve

shed inside yourself were
not at all in vain they are
but what God is calling
back to His domain
& you know He
loves you
need I
say

just

the same
